Bergenia 'Silberlicht' SILVERLIGHT
Bergenia 'Silberlicht' SILVERLIGHT is an amazing plant species for the landscape due to its durability and its ornamental values. SILVERLIGHT produces grey-green foliage with striking silver veins, which glows in full sun. As well as offering dramatic colors and texture to a garden, it also tolerates some serious weather conditions with its strong and leathery foliage, making it an ideal choice for a low-maintenance garden. It produces large vibrant pink or white flowers during the spring, and offers additional evergreen foliage in the Winter months adding color to the land all year long.
